Output 4adf302a1de7457fc97a930c3b03d8ab4e1ac64b06b518846c6efed0386457cf:0

value
18695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8bf577c4f815a59231a93b3c2f5d284e5b181c4 OP_EQUAL
address
3MT56drsShd8BsA1nbmEDxdoKdQqLWDHUU
transaction
4adf302a1de7457fc97a930c3b03d8ab4e1ac64b06b518846c6efed0386457cf
confirmations
132444
spent
true